# GE dishwasher error code C6

### What C6 means, in the maker’s own words

The water temperature is too low. GE is specific about the number: the water coming into the dishwasher should be at least 120°F, and in a house where the kitchen is a long way from the heater it will not be on the first fill.

### Where this code actually appears

On the control panel, and usually with a sound. GE describes their refrigerator codes as flashing green on the display and typically accompanied by a beeping, and the range, microwave and dishwasher tables all describe codes you can read from the front of the appliance. That is the opposite of some makes, where the number is written into a hidden log and never shown — here, if something is wrong, the appliance generally tells you. Photograph what it says before cutting the power, because a reset erases it and the code is most of the diagnosis.

### What to do about it

- Run the faucet next to the dishwasher before starting it, to purge the cold water sitting in the line. This is GE’s own advice and it costs nothing.
- Check the water heater setting.
- Do not run the washing machine or take showers while the dishwasher is filling — GE names this too, and in a busy household it is the real cause.
- Use the options that make the cycle run longer, which adds heat.
- If the water arriving is genuinely 120°F and the code persists, the temperature sensing circuit is next — that is C7.
